1. Bud Light: The Reigning Champion

Bud Light: The Reigning Champion

Bud Light consistently ranks as the best selling beer in America. Known for its crisp, refreshing taste and lower calorie count, Bud Light is a favorite for many. Its widespread availability and extensive marketing campaigns have solidified its position at the top.

3. Coors Light: A Refreshing Choice

Coors Light: A Refreshing Choice

Coors Light is well-known for its refreshing taste and is often a top pick for those looking for a light beer. Its unique cold-activated technology, which turns the mountains on the label blue when cold, has made it a recognizable choice among beer drinkers.

5. Michelob Ultra: The Fitness Beer

Michelob Ultra: The Fitness Beer

For health-conscious drinkers, Michelob Ultra is a go-to option. With only 95 calories and 2.6 grams of carbs, it has carved out a niche as the “fitness beer,” appealing to those who want to enjoy a cold one without derailing their health goals.

7. What is the difference between lagers and ales?
Lagers are fermented at lower temperatures, resulting in a cleaner, crisper taste. Ales are fermented at warmer temperatures, leading to a more complex and fruity flavor profile.
